Output 25847ec786e77aa0be71807b1520efc417f17f75f860472a1bc8b46662959e25:10

value
73121136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a421672b7c1358cc2de49e043d658f75af3e4fb OP_EQUAL
address
M8qQACeGrCgQyuYANSpuPq9Hrr3VSiFZ6j
transaction
25847ec786e77aa0be71807b1520efc417f17f75f860472a1bc8b46662959e25
spent
true